Fans couldn't help but flood Gorka Marquez with the same comment as he shared a candid parenting moment with his baby son. The Strictly Come Dancing star has been able to spend more time at home after leaving the BBC One dance contest in week three last month.
But his exit from the competition meant that he could return home after weeks away due to training with Nikita in London. Gorka's role in the show meant that he had to leave his fiancee Gemma Atkinson back in Greater Manchester with their two children - four-year-old Mia and baby son, Thiago. In the first adorable snap showed the Spanish dancer smiling for the camera as Thiago, known as Tio for short, sat on his dad's lap and looked in the same direction with a bit of a pout. But it was the next photo that showed Gorka looking a bit unimpressed as his son had had a little accident on his arm.
Hits Radio host Gemma was quick to respond to the post as she noted something else about the string of images. "I love that he looks like he’s got elastic bands around his arms." Fans, however, couldn't help but share how they much they thought Tio already resembled his mum.
